<p align="left"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S"><strong>Nectarine and Blueberry Pie</strong></font></p>
<p align="left"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S"><a href="http://sweetpaul.typepad.com/my_weblog/">Sweet Paul</a></font></p>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S"><o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Serves 8</font></p>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S"><o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">&nbsp;4 cups plain flour</font></p>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S"><o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1 teaspoon salt<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1 tablespoon sugar<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1 3/4 cups unsalted cold butter, in cubes<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1 tablespoon white vinegar<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1 large egg<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1/2 cup iced water<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;<font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S"> <o:p></o:p></font></div>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Combine flour, salt and sugar in a large bowl.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Add butter and use your fingers until the mixture resembles coarse meal.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Mix vinegar, egg and water in a bowl and mix into the flour with your hands just until combined.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Press the dough gently together, wrap in plastic and chill for at least 1 hour.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Take it out and roll it flat.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Fill a 9 inch pie plate with it.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Cut of excess dough.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Cut out small circles with a cookie cutter to go around the edge of the pie.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al">&nbsp;</p>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Filling:</font></p>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S"><o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">5 nectarines, pitted and sliced<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1/2 cup blueberries<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">2 tablespoons plain flour<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">2 tablespoons lemon juice<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1 tablespoon sugar<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1 egg<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">1 tablespoon milk<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Place the nectarines and blueberries in a bowl and toss with flour.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Place it in the pie shell. Pour over the lemon juice and sprinkle with sugar.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Line the edge of the pie with the small dough circles.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Beat egg and milk and brush the dough with it.<o:p></o:p></font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Bake at 450F for about 40 minutes, or until golden.</font></p>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al">&nbsp;</p>
<p align="left" class="MsoNormal"><font size="2" face="Comic Sans MS">Cool and serve.<o:p></o:p></font></p>

<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" size="2"><font color="#993300"><strong>Chocolate Peanut Butter Love</strong></font></font></p>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" size="2"><a href="http://nectarandlight.typepad.com/my_weblog/2008/02/hello-friends-i.html">Nectar &amp; Light</a></font></p>
<p align="left">&nbsp;</p>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 1 c. butter {room temp}</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 1 1/4 c. peanut butter {preferably smooth Jif}</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 1 c. sugar</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 1/2 c. honey</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 2 organic eggs</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 1/2 t. vanilla</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 2 1/2 c. flour</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 1 t. baking powder</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 1 t. baking soda</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">~ 1 c. chocolate chips</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">Preheat oven to 350.&nbsp; Smooth butter and peanut butter together &#8211; add sugar and mix until well blended.&nbsp; Add honey and mix.&nbsp; In a small bowl, whisk eggs and vanilla &#8211; add to butter mixture and incorporate well.&nbsp; In another bowl, whisk flour, baking soda and baking powder together &#8211; slowly add to wet mixture.&nbsp; Scrap the bottom of the bowl several times to ensure all of the dry is properly mixed into the wet.&nbsp; Stir in chocolate chips.</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">Place the dough in the refrigerator for up to 30 minutes.&nbsp; Prepare baking sheets with parchment paper.&nbsp; Using an ice cream scoop {or tablespoon}, create {somewhat} equal sized balls of dough &#8211; spacing them about two inches apart on the baking sheet.&nbsp; Return the dough to the fridge between each sheeting.&nbsp; Do NOT flatten the dough with a fork or any other means.&nbsp; Bake each sheet for 12 minutes or until edges just begin to turn gold.&nbsp; Pull from the oven and let the cookies stand for about 5 minutes before transferring to a cooling rack.</font></p>
<div align="left">&nbsp;</div>
<p align="left"><font face="Comic Sans MS" color="#993300" size="2">*These freeze beautifully and defrost quickly if you really must have one right away <img src='http://www.thecookingadventuresofchefpaz.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_wink.gif' alt=';)' class='wp-smiley' /> </font></p>
